What does overcook mean?

Looking for the meaning or definition of the word overcook? Here's what it means.

Verb
  1. (transitive) To cook for too long or at too high a temperature.
  2. To do something to excess; to overdo.

Examples
Wash and trim the scallops and then griddle them until juicy but do not overcook.
Keep cooked meats hot by setting them to the side of the grill, not directly over coals where they can overcook.
If you overcook your jam, the sugar will caramelize and it won't taste good and there's nothing you can do.
Don't forget, though, that asparagus is also delicious raw and so always aim to undercook rather than overcook it.
Place in an oven and check every five minutes taking care not to allow the rhubarb to overcook.
This parasite is the reason why past generations have tended to overcook pork.
